Output 7a998533f8ff781ecd84a820a8828f81f5a71bc0019b4cde8d26078675f6b531:0

value
28444726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5377ba20dc357ee23d51fd94c1a6737a1e3bd16 OP_EQUAL
address
3Nb18VgNLdW9VPDeP1iUKmGi6bJbvjBuPC
transaction
7a998533f8ff781ecd84a820a8828f81f5a71bc0019b4cde8d26078675f6b531
confirmations
281446
spent
true